Miller & Carter Wheathampstead Features & Promotions
If you share our love of steak, then be sure to keep an eye at Miller & Carter Wheathampstead for food offers, special features and a few of our trade secrets...
Want to be the first in St Albans to know about some of our best restaurant deals? Register for an account with Miller & Carter and unlock a world of exclusive benefits.